Smart Clothing Towards Sustainability: Bibliographic Review on Clothing Innovation and Emerging Technologies

The clothing sector, once embracing the use of emerging digital technologies, such as artificial intelligence, big data, blockchain, and the Internet of Things (IoT), can offer a new range of products and, most importantly, integrate new services in association with its clothes. Also, new technologies in the fashion industry can help to implement Sustainability solutions and to establish clothing as a service. Once this is already a reality in the apparel industry and a topic in the academic literature, this article aims to investigate through a bibliographic review what is the state of the art of smart clothing and emerging technologies in the clothing sector and what are the relationships with the provision of services through clothing. The results indicate the possibility of products with positive impacts both in people´s lives and for the environment, but it alerts to the risks of ecological impacts and issues in personal data safety if not designed properly.
